A Biased View of Software Companies In Indianapolis

Wiki Article

Getting The Software Companies In Indianapolis To Work

Table of Contents3 Simple Techniques For Software Companies In IndianapolisHow Software Companies In Indianapolis can Save You Time, Stress, and Money.Excitement About Software Companies In IndianapolisSoftware Companies In Indianapolis Fundamentals ExplainedThe Basic Principles Of Software Companies In Indianapolis Not known Incorrect Statements About Software Companies In Indianapolis The smart Trick of Software Companies In Indianapolis That Nobody is DiscussingSome Known Facts About Software Companies In Indianapolis.
PHP is still extensively used and also taken into consideration an excellent language for beginners in programming languages. SQL is a programs language famously utilized for updating, obtaining, as well as adjusting databases.

The factor for this is the quick adoption of the current software development technologies in a variety of industries like medical care, production, and also bookkeeping. The demand for software program growth talents is anticipated to boost in the coming years. Nevertheless, as you stay up to date with the information concerning software application development and the existing trends, you might also have an interest in these new and also future modern technologies.


In significance, software program is a set of directions or programs that govern a system's actions. Software application growth includes the procedure of creating, designing, deploying, and supporting software. At a high degree, there are 4 sorts of software application:. This software application furnishes an offered gadget or system with core features, such as the operating system, disk administration, energies, and hardware monitoring.

Software Companies In Indianapolis Can Be Fun For Everyone

This software application aids users carry out jobs. Instances include office applications, information monitoring software program, media players, safety programs, and also a lot more.

While Dev, Ops can give a variety of benefits, it can be bothersome for a variety of companies. This is particularly true for companies that are not well matched to having applications continually updated. This can include business with rigorous regulative requirements and also with consumers that have constraints around upgrade regularity.

Generally, the process complies with these stages: requirements, style, application, confirmation, and maintenance. Each stage has a distinct goal, and each action must be finished completely before transferring to the following. In many organizations, this represents the typical technique, so it is usually comfortable and well understood for numerous employee.

Software Companies In Indianapolis Can Be Fun For Everyone

In addition, it can be difficult for groups to adjust to transforming demands that may develop throughout advancement. This is a non-linear advancement technique that condenses design as well as code building and construction.

Software Companies in IndianapolisSoftware Companies in Indianapolis
Within the majority of companies, groups establish various settings for advancement, screening, hosting, and also manufacturing. By doing this, developers can create and innovate, without breaking anything in the production environment. A facility collection of components are required for each software application advancement environment: A physical or virtual machine, including an underlying operating system, data source system, and so forth.

A software application development environment can play a big function in the stability, reliability, and also best success of a software program offering. These environments: Play an important duty in software program production, management, and upkeep.

The 2-Minute Rule for Software Companies In Indianapolis

In making this choice, groups must try to find a remedy that is well straightened with the kind of my site app being created, including appropriate languages, platforms, deployments, gadgets, and also so on. A designer may want to develop an application that can run on i, OS and also Android mobile gadgets, as well as via a web page.

, so others can communicate with solutions running on their design templates.



The three major areas of development planning are Demands Gathering, Planning as well as Style, and also Study and Growth. The main stakeholders are typically customers, so target tests can be a good way to make clear essential concerns when working with a tiny example of the target market.

Software Companies In Indianapolis Fundamentals Explained

Functions are damaged down into smaller jobs so that they can be approximated extra accurately. Software Companies in Indianapolis. The phase is a bit similar to the preparation phase. When some major attributes are brand-new, essential, and risky, you have to conduct directory research study regarding their application to lower these dangers in the production stage

To create an efficient software growth plan, it is extremely crucial to recognize how crucial its top quality is to the success of the product. Below are the most typical phases of a software application advancement job. You can use them as a guide when detailing the stages and also components of any job.

Here are some vital points to keep in mind: Alignment. How does this project fit into the mission and also objectives of the business? Resources. Does the company have sufficient sources to make the task a success? Preparation. How does this project fit in with the schedule of various other jobs as well as goals? Price.

An Unbiased View of Software Companies In Indianapolis

This clearness makes it simpler to anticipate the result of the job, both for the client as well as for the firm. Defining objectives is also important for writing a realistic and also succinct task plan. The software should automate certain tasks, increase productivity, or enhance procedures. The exact objective ought to be clear.

With Dev, Absolutely no, designers can create new atmospheres by logging onto a console and selecting from numerous design templates or producing their very own themes. Whenever required, designers can conveniently share their atmospheres, so others can communicate with services running on their templates. To get more information, make certain to visit the Dev, Absolutely no item page.

The 3 main areas of advancement preparation are Demands Collecting, Preparation and Design, and also Research Study as well as Development. The major stakeholders are see page generally clients, so target tests can be an excellent way to clarify essential problems when working with a tiny sample of the target market.

Some Known Details About Software Companies In Indianapolis

Features are broken down into smaller tasks so that they can be estimated extra properly. The phase is a bit similar to the planning stage. When some major attributes are brand-new, critical, and high-risk, you need to conduct study regarding their application to decrease these risks in the production phase.

To create an effective software application advancement strategy, it is extremely important to recognize exactly how vital its quality is to the success of the product. Below are the most common stages of a software program advancement job. You can utilize them as a guide when describing the phases and also elements of any project.

Exactly how does this project fit into the goal and also objectives of the company? Does the company have enough resources to make the project a success? Just how does this job fit in with the schedule of various other jobs as well as objectives?

The Facts About Software Companies In Indianapolis Uncovered

Software Companies in IndianapolisSoftware Companies in Indianapolis
Specifying goals is additionally essential for creating a practical and also concise job plan. The software application should automate specific tasks, boost performance, or optimize procedures.

Report this wiki page